We have several courses where learners are given 3 opportunities to retake a summative assessment. We'd like to make it possible for learners to retake the course if they fail the 3 assessment attempts, without having to manually reset progress. Is it possible to do this automatically?

    At the moment, unfortunately we don't have a way to automatically reset a user's progress in a course based on failed assessment attempts.

    We truly appreciate your feedback and have identified this as a feature request. Please note that at present, there are some existing PIE ideas for similar requests.
